MTN BlackBerry service for Pay-as-you-go customers

Posted on 20. Nov, 2009 by Nana Kwabena Owusu in News

The BlackBerry Service from RIM is now available from several cell phone companies in Ghana (MTN, Tigo, Zain) but it has always been a service available to postpaid customers.

An SMS I recevied yesterday indicates that MTN has launched (or is in the latter stages of launching) a BlackBerry Service package for prepaid customers. I do not know if the SMS went out to all customers or a selected group. I think it went out to existing BlackBerry service users.

The service will cost GHC 40.00 per month, the same as it costs on the postpaid plan. Based on this pricing it seems the plan will be similar to the postpaid and will therefore include a 2GB data plan. Let me clarify that this seems not to be a Pay-as-you-go BlackBerry service but rather a monthly BlackBerry service for prepaid customers.

Postpaid accounts deter a lot of customers because of the initial deposits required and this prepaid offering makes MTN very competitive. Compare this prepaid plan to;

MTN Postapaid BIS: Deposit (GHC 50.00) + 1 Month BIS Service Fee (GHC 40.00) = GHC 90.00
Zain Postpaid BIS: Deposit (GHC 100.00) + 1 Month BIS Service Fee (GHC 40.00) = GHC 140.00

With this offering it may not be a far stretch for MTN to launch BlackBerry Connect, which is a service which allows non-RIM devices (such as Asus, HTC, Motorola, Nokia, and Sony Ericsson) to use BlackBerry push technology for email and calendar synchronization and internet browsing.
